How Simple Rules Create Unstoppable Computation
At the heart of powerful computation lies an unexpected truth: minimal, clear rules can generate extraordinary outcomes. From prime number distribution to recursive sequences, simplicity acts as the engine behind scalable, resilient systems. This article explores how foundational principles—like the prime counting function π(x), the Collatz conjecture, and natural growth models—reveal computation’s hidden architecture, using the living metaphor of Happy Bamboo to illustrate these timeless patterns.
The Power of Simple Rules in Computation
Simple rules are not limitations—they are gateways to complexity. The prime counting function π(x) ≈ x/ln(x) offers a striking example: though defining exact primes is nontrivial, this approximation reveals a probabilistic order underlying their distribution. Similarly, the Collatz sequence—defined by the rule “if n even, divide by 2; if odd, multiply by 3 and add 1”—is deterministic yet exhibits behavior that defies early prediction, yet always converges to 1, proving its resilience. These rules, though minimal, unlock profound computational depth.
- The Collatz sequence exemplifies a loop where no exception has been found in verified ranges up to 2⁶⁸, demonstrating computational stability through simplicity.
- In nature, the Happy Bamboo system mirrors this principle: modular segments grow via predictable division rules, branching organically to optimize resource capture, much like rule-based computation accumulates complexity through iteration.
- From math to machine, the same logic applies—simple rules resist breakdown under scale, enable parallel processing, and adapt through small adjustments, forming the backbone of unstoppable systems.
Foundations of Unstoppable Computation
Behind every resilient system lies a bedrock of mathematical certainty. The pigeonhole principle—ensuring outcomes in finite containers—forms a cornerstone: given n items and m containers, at least ⌈n/m⌉ items share a container. This guarantees distribution, forming the basis for probabilistic reasoning in computation.
| Guarantee | What it ensures | Example application |
|---|---|---|
| Distribution | At least ⌈n/m⌉ items fall into one category | Prime density estimation across intervals |
| Pigeonhole Principle | Finite containers capture all items | Verified ranges up to 2⁶⁸ show no gaps |
| Computational resilience | No exceptions found in repeated checks | Collatz loop confirms convergence |
Happy Bamboo: A Living Algorithm
Happy Bamboo embodies rule-based growth in nature. Its modular segments divide and branch predictably, following simple, repeatable patterns. Yet from these basics emerge complex branching networks that optimize sunlight and nutrient capture—mirroring how deterministic rules in computation scale into emergent intelligence.
- A bamboo system thrives not through complexity, but through consistent application of segment division rules.
- Each division follows deterministic logic: segment splits, length adjusts, new nodes form—just as a loop iterates a rule to build complex structures.
- This natural algorithm reveals how simplicity enables optimization: resource distribution follows built-in rules, not centralized control.
From Mathematics to Machine: Parallel Patterns in Computation
Prime counting and the Collatz loop share a deep trait: simplicity of rule → scalability of outcome. Whether estimating π(x) across millions or tracing Collatz paths, the same principle applies—clear instructions generate vast, consistent behavior.
Consider the prime number theorem: π(x) ≈ x/ln(x) approximates prime density with elegant simplicity, yet underpins cryptographic security and algorithm design. Similarly, the Collatz sequence’s deterministic loops offer self-verifying behavior, requiring no feedback—just rules.
| Shared trait | Mathematical example | Computational analog | Rule simplicity | π(x) ≈ x/ln(x) | Rule: if n even → n/2 | Predictable output from minimal instruction | Collatz: always reaches 1 | Scalable verification without exhaustive check | Prime counting verified via asymptotic approximation |
|---|
Why Simple Rules Drive Unstoppable Systems
Simple rules reduce fragility—when a system depends on few, clear instructions, it withstands scale and variation. They enable parallel execution, as each rule applies independently across containers or branches, multiplying throughput without coordination overhead.
“Small changes in rule yield robust, evolving behavior—resilience through clarity.” — Insight from computational biology and distributed systems theory
Adaptability follows: tweak a rule, and the system evolves, much like bamboo adjusting growth in response to light. This balance of stability and flexibility makes simple-rule systems the true engine of unstoppable computation.
Conclusion: Rules as the Engine of Computation
Across prime numbers, sequences, and natural growth, simplicity is the silent architect. π(x), Collatz, and Happy Bamboo each demonstrate that powerful computation need not rely on complexity—it thrives on clarity. These principles guide how we design systems that scale, endure, and adapt.
Rules are not constraints—they are the foundation of what’s possible. In a world of ever-growing demands, mastering simple rules ensures computation remains not just effective, but sustainable.
Explore how nature’s rules inspire unstoppable systems